Kindle version of our illustrated travel guide will take you to Aruba, the Caribbean island 15 miles north of Venezuela and an autonomous dependency of the Netherlands.
This flat, riverless island is renowned for its white sand beaches. Its tropical climate is moderated by constant trade winds from the Atlantic Ocean. The temperature is almost constant at about 27°C (81°F). The yearly rainfall usually does not exceed 20 inches. Aruba is outside of the Caribbean hurricane belt.
The southwest has the white sand beaches, turquoise seas, and warm waters. The northeast coast, exposed to the Atlantic, has a few white sand beaches, cacti, rough seas with treacherous currents, and a rocky coastline.
